PLAWASH’s English Programs in Peru are part of the Association’s broader commitment to community education, professional development, and long-term empowerment. Through structured, community-based initiatives, these programs support students in developing English language skills that contribute to academic growth, confidence, and future professional opportunities.
Currently, PLAWASH supports English education initiatives in multiple regions of Peru, including Vetnailla,Trujillo and Chimbote, working in collaboration with educators and local partners to create inclusive and supportive learning environments. While English language development is the central focus, the programs also emphasize values such as collaboration, cultural awareness, and community engagement.

These initiatives are made possible through collaborative efforts and sustained local support, reflecting a shared commitment to expanding access to education and strengthening opportunities for students across diverse communities.
